I don't know how you manage 3 or more builds on the go at once, but that MR.3 is looking good, think I need to get 1
It's easy having three kits on the go at once, but it's all the railway commissions that get in the way 😉
With this modern glues (Tamiya Extra Thin etc), I've learn't before paint, let the plane kits have adequate drying time - a few weeks in some cases, as what seems like a perfect invisible seam can be a canyon in a weeks time, hence I appear to have a few kits on the go at once.
The Revell Shackleton is a nice kit, but all that rivet detail makes it a pain to get the decals sitting down ( I had to use X-20A in the end).
